Step 1: Assessment and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and assess the extent of the dam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process. Our team is trained to handle any size job, from small leaks to major floods.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ry the area and remove any excess mo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ring a thorough restoration. Our team uses the latest equipment to ensure a fast and efficient drying process.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
After the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ent any further damage or health risks. This step is crucial in ensuring a safe and healthy environment for your customers and employees. Our team uses eco-friendly cleaning products and follows the industry’s best practices to ensure a thorough cleaning.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Once the area is clean and sanitized, we’ll restore your store to its original condition. This may include repairing damaged walls, flooring, or equipment.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Snowville, ID
The cost of retail store water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Snowville, ID. These estimates are based on industry averages and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ate and plan to restore your store to its original condition.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air. |
